Description:
-
Three hours per week. An advanced course in children's and adolescent's literature whichfocuses special attention on the appropriate methods and media to meet the needs of individual children and groups of children, preschool through high school. Designed for teachers with a background in the field of reading and children's and adolescent's literature whowant to extend their knowledge through individual and group work.
